Hi Marius,

I found a bug while editing a track:

RadioDJ plays audio on 'Monitoring (CUE)'-soundcard while editor is open on the currently track being played from the queue. This only occurs when opening the editor by double-clicking the track in the queue. Searching for the track using the Track Manager, right-clicking it and selecting 'Edit Track' will not invoke this behaviour.

Reproduction:

- A track is playing, 2 or more tracks are in the queue.
- RadioDJ is on AUTOMATED.
- Double-click on the top track in the queue to open the editor for that track.
- Wait until the current track has finished (or double-click to the end of the current track to speed things up)

RadioDJ will now play the next track in the playlist (the one currently open in the editor) through the 'Monitoring (CUE)'-soundcard instead of the Main soundcard.
RadioDJ will function normally, ie.: the progress bar will advance, timers will run normally, the track is just played on the wrong soundcard. The controls in the editor can be used to stop the track from playing, after which RadioDJ will automatically advance to the next item in the queue and start playing the next song, on the correct soundcard.
